Position: Traveling Security Control Assessor with Security Clearance
R
- Description Leidos is seeking mid- to senior-level Security Control Assessors to join our SCA team. This position requires significant travel—please review the position overview below for important details. The maximum starting salary for this role is $112,500. A Top Secret clearance and current IAT/IAM II certification (eg Security+ or equivalent) is required for consideration. POSITION OVERVIEW As a Security Control Assessor, you will play a key role in conducting Security Control Assessments at various government sites, with approximately 85% of your time on travel assignments.

Travel may be domestic or international, depending on mission requirements, and per diem is provided to cover expenses . You'll have the flexibility to work from home when not on assignment, but must be local to one of our three locations for training and occasional customer meetings - Alexandria, VA, Fort Meade, MD, or Chambersburg, PA. Your first few weeks will involve assessment training in a virtual classroom environment, which includes training modules, lectures, and exams.

You will also gain hands-on experience by shadowing current Assessors on local assessments across the greater DC-Baltimore area (referred to as "check rides"). Once your training and check rides are successfully completed, you will be added to the regular travel schedule.

Key Responsibilities:

* Conduct cybersecurity assessments, audits, and inspections for DoD organizations and partners handling DoD information or connecting to the DoDIN.  
* Evaluate systems and Defensive Cyberspace Operations using cyber threat emulation and performance-based testing.  
* Adhere to policies and processes for each assessment type.  
* Support assessment development and execution to ensure security expertise is properly applied.  
* Coordinate logistics, test plans, and scope with the SCA Team Lead.  
* Perform vulnerability assessments, capture results using STIG Viewer or designated tools, and document findings in eMASS.  
* Analyze security gaps and provide mitigation recommendations.  
* Validate cybersecurity controls, TTPs, STIGs, RMF controls, and compliance with DoD policies and guidelines.

* Provide risk analysis and assessment results for authorization recommendations.  
* Participate in daily assessment reviews, in-briefs, and out-briefs, sharing findings with the SCA-R.  
* Mentor and guide personnel by providing technical expertise, best practices, and professional development support to enhance team capabilities and knowledge

Basic Qualifications:

* Active DoD Top Secret clearance with SCI eligibility required
* Current DoD 8570 IAM II or IAT II certification  
* Ability and willingness to travel for assessments as required, up to 85% of the time
* Bachelor's degree (IT-related field preferred) and eight (8) years of cybersecurity or network security experience, including five (5) years of experience in a Certification and Accreditation/A&A role. Additional relevant experience may be considered in lieu of degree.
* Demonstrated experience with STIGs, SRGs, POA&Ms and cybersecurity best practices, as well as relevant tools such as eMASS, STIG Viewer, Nessus, ACAS, SCAP, or HBSS  
* Strong understanding of the RMF process, NIST SP 800- 37, NIST SP 800-53, CNSSI 1253, as well as key technologies areas/domain such as:
Network, Mobility, Windows, UNIX, Cloud Environments and Cloud Native Tools/Services, Host Based Security System (HBSS)/Endpoint Security Solutions (ESS), Databases, Applications  
* Strong written and verbal communication skills for reporting assessment findings --- The maximum starting salary for this position is $112,500.
